Web3 Technology

Definition ∞ Web3 technology refers to the next iteration of the internet, built on decentralized principles. This conceptual framework envisions an internet where users possess greater control over their data and digital identities, operating on decentralized networks like blockchains rather than centralized servers. It leverages cryptographic protocols, smart contracts, and distributed ledger technology to enable peer-to-peer interactions and permissionless innovation. Key characteristics include decentralization, user ownership of data, and native payment layers via cryptocurrencies. Web3 applications aim to provide enhanced transparency, security, and resistance to censorship.
Context ∞ The discussion around Web3 technology frequently centers on its potential to reshape digital ownership, online commerce, and social interactions by shifting power from corporations to individuals. A key debate involves the practical challenges of scalability, user experience, and regulatory oversight for widespread adoption of these decentralized systems. Future developments will likely focus on improving infrastructure, interoperability between different blockchains, and creating more intuitive applications. News often reports on new Web3 projects, investment trends, and the ongoing debate about its transformative potential versus its current limitations.
